Job Description

• Possesses Lifeguard certification and authorized to conduct AR and CPR.
• Ensures set-up of safety equipment at the beach/pool which includes set up of life saving floatation devices along the shoreline/around the pool; correct flag must be in placed during business hours; rescue surfboard/boat ready on the shoreline; first aid kit; posting of business hours; depth of the pool; water & air temperatures; wind force & wind speed.
• Keeps the designated and marked swimming areas free of any engine driven boat or alike, windsurfers, or sea bikes (pedalos).
• Ensures that swimmers/snorkels are out of boat tracks or any hazardous areas.
• Supervises the use of windsurf and sea bikes including the log in and log out of guests, monitoring the action of wind surfers and those engaged in other water activities while out on the sea.
• Responds to any emergency within the hotel, resort swimming areas including ensuring that rescue boat is available at all times.
• Ensures that all water sports activities or pool activities are executed according to Security and Safety regulations.
• Performs other duties that may be assigned from time to time.



Qualifications

Lifeguard Qualifications / Skills:


  • Knowledge and ability to evaluate water conditions at aquatics facilities, at the beach/ocean, or other offsite natural pools, streams, or rivers to determine any potential dangers or hazards
  • Ability to adjust programs as necessary to ensure the safety of the visitors and other staff
  • Swimming proficiency and comfort in all types of water conditions
  • Ability to judge and evaluate evolving dynamics of individuals participating in aquatic activities to immediately assess their capabilities and threats to their safety
  • Knowledge of on-site protocols, operational procedures, and safety policies
  • Knowledge of methods and techniques for providing on-site emergency medical services

Education, Experience, and Licensing Requirements:


  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Minimum of 1 year of related work experience
  • Certified Red Cross Lifeguard Training Certificate, or equivalent
  • Red Cross CPR for the Professional Rescuer, or equivalent
  • Red Cross Standard First Aid, or equivalent
